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9549 98370 5361522 63795 4236918
6522140322 1634947440
6522140322 1634947440
686030 2651 153832476
All about undefined
Interested in learning more?
6522140322 1634947440
686030 2651 153832476
See more
24402982 8409426 5436304642
003 698 3145469161 160
See more
311 18 20818
48 08084446 92401913
See more